What is a Substance Abuse Professional (SAP)?
The Substance Abuse Professional (SAP) is a person who evaluates employees who have violated a DOT drug and alcohol program regulation and makes recommendations concerning education, treatment, follow-up testing, and aftercare. The evaluation is required by the Department of Transportation (DOT) to determine the nature and extent of the person’s alcohol and/or substance use and to assist them in obtaining treatment, if necessary. All education and treatment recommendations need to be completed before an employee can return to a safety sensitive job after testing positive for drugs and/or alcohol.

What is the fee for Substance Abuse Professional Services?
Correctly carrying out the SAP process requires quite a bit of professional time and expertise on the part of the SAP. A SAP has considerable liability, since DOT considers the SAP to be ultimately responsible to the traveling public. Kabba Recovery Services charges $500 for the SAP services provided, payable at the first visit. This fee includes the Initial Evaluation by a qualified SAP, referral services to appropriate providers, continuous monitoring of your progress, reporting to your employer or DER (Designated Employer Representative), communicating with the MRO (Medical Review Officer) as needed, and the Follow-Up Evaluation. As part of the SAP process you will be referred to an education or treatment program. The fees for that provider’s services are not covered in the $500 fee paid to Kabba Recovery Services.
What are DOT-Regulated & SAP Required Agencies?
- Federal Aviation Administration (FAA)
-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A)
- Federal Railroad Administration (FRA)
- Federal Transit Administration (FTA)
- Pipeline & Hazardous Materials Safety Administration (PHMSA)
- United States Coast Guard (USCG)
